Dive

No big story behind this. I wanted to do a funky dance rock number to get people hopping when we play live. I think this fits the bill.

The lyrics were written in about ten minutes. I kind of just free associated thoughts of American pop culture and water images...TV reruns and movies that fascinated me. (Either that, or I was trying to write a theme song for Speilberg's DIVE! restaurants in a blatant sell-out attempt to get Dreamworks Records to sign our band. Stuff art. Let's dance!)
